TEETH IMPLANTS
Losing your natural teeth disrupts the natural balance of the mouth. A tooth implant is essentially a post that replaces the missing tooth root. When topped with a dental restoration such as a crown, bridge, or denture, the result is a fully functioning tooth replacement. PROCEDURAL EXPECTATIONS
A consultation with the dentist is required to determine your oral health needs and to establish a treatment plan. The implant procedure requires more than one appointment. During the first visit, the implant is positioned in place of the missing tooth or teeth. Once healed, the abutment is attached so the crown, bridge, or denture can be placed to complete the restoration.

RECOVERY PROCESS
After the initial implant placement, the mouth needs time to heal. The bone and soft tissues are given time to accept and heal.

For patients with missing teeth, this permanent replacement option restores your smile’s appearance and function. A single tooth or multiple teeth can be replaced.
Unlike dentures or fixed bridges, implants replace the tooth root which keeps the jaw bone healthy. This protects the adjacent teeth and gum tissues, prevents bone loss, and reduces the risk of gum disease.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S
DENTAL IMPLANTS
Dental implants are often made of titanium. The same material is used for hip, shoulder, and knee implants. Titanium implants are highly biocompatible. Allergies are rare.
Procedures are tailored to the individual patient so the price varies. Contributing factors include the number and location of the posts and if there has been any gum or bone loss. Restorations may be covered by insurance. However, situations and types of insurance vary. Check with your insurance company first to determine your coverage benefits. The total cost and coverage may depend on the number of restorations needed, the patient’s bone quality, and the region of the mouth being treated.
PROCEDURE
Every patient is unique and has a different tolerance level. Most patients report less discomfort than expected following the procedure. A local anesthetic is used during the treatment to maintain the patient’s comfort. Afterwards, antibiotics and pain medication may be recommended to avoid infection and to ease discomfort.
Every treatment plan is customized and varies based on the number of teeth being replaced, if extractions or bone grafts are needed first, the area of the mouth being treated, and your overall oral health.
The process requires more than one appointment. Once the implant is placed, the mouth needs time to heal. The process known as osseointegration takes place where the bone and gums heal around the implant.
Once healed, the restoration can be attached. Your dentist will give you a more detailed assessment of your treatment needs during your consultation.
Once placed, dental implants are fixed, permanent structures in the mouth. Unlike removable dentures, these posts can only be removed by a dentist or oral surgeon.
RECOVERY
These restorations may be titanium or zirconium. The implant technology is sophisticated, safe, and reliable.
Healing time varies from patient to patient depending on the number of restorations needed and the patient’s overall health. Most patients heal in 6-12 weeks.
Dental implants are highly successful, long term replacements for missing teeth. With good oral hygiene, they can last a lifetime and will not decay.
